Correction to:Journal of Biomedical Researchhttps://doi.org/10.7555/JBR.27.20120114, published on 30 September 2013.
We apologize for the misused images inFig.7in our article published on 30 September 2013.TheFig.7by HE staining and immunohistochemistry were partially misused because of our carelessness.Because we couldn't find the original pictures acquired 11 years ago, thus HE and IHC experiments were repeated by our previously reserved wax blocks.Now, the pictures taken by microscope imaging system in each group were collected and combined, respectively.The correct version ofFig.7C,E, andFare shown below.This correction does not affect the conclusion reported in the study.
